About Keiichi Tamura

Keiichi Tamura is a scholar working on Signal Processing, Geography, Planning and Development and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ics, having authored 63 papers that have together received 341 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Complex Network Analysis Techniques (13 papers), Time Series Analysis and Forecasting (9 papers) and Anomaly Detection Techniques and Applications (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Civil and Structural Engineering (163 citations), Signal Processing (54 citations) and Transportation (26 citations). Keiichi Tamura has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Mitsu Okamura, Masanori Ishihara, Takumi Ichimura, Tetsuhiro Sakai, Shigeki Unjoh, Hiroshi Kobayashi, Yasushi Sasaki, Toshiyuki Takezawa, Yoshifumi Takahashi and Yoshitaka Kawai. Their work appears in journals such as The Laryngoscope, Journal of Geotechnical and Geoenvironmental Engineering and Soil Dynamics and Earthquake Engineering.
